TOKYO LOOKS TO SUPPORT FUEL CELLS AND CLEAN TRANSPORTATION FOR 2020 OLYMPIC GAMES

The City of Tokyo has big plans for the 2020 Olympic Games. The city intends to help make it easier for residents to purchase fuel cell vehicles, which are expected to become significantly more common in the coming years. The Tokyo government will be launching 385 million in vehicle subsidies and initiatives meant to expand the city's hydrogen fuel infrastructure. This is part of a larger effort from the national government, which aims to reduce Japan's reliance on nuclear energy and fossil-fuels.

FUEL CELLS HAVE FOUND A STRONG ADVOCATE IN JAPAN


After the 2011 Fukushima Daiichi nuclear disaster, which is the worst nuclear even Japan has suffered since World War II, the government has been working to distance the country from nuclear energy. There was a significant energy deficit in the wake of the disaster, much of which was satisfied through the use of hydrogen fuel cells. These energy systems were able to provide enough electrical power to keep homes and businesses supplied with energy. This is where Japan's favor for these energy systems began to gain momentum.

Japan Continues Its Work To Establish A Hydrogen Society


The 2020 Olympic Games may serve as a promising time for Japan to show off its notions of a "hydrogen society." This involves developing a society in which the majority of its energy comes from hydrogen and fuel cell systems. In order to make this dream a reality, the government has been investing in the development of a comprehensive hydrogen fuel infrastructure and promoting the adoption of fuel cell systems among homeowners and businesses.

Tokyo May Soon Become A Hub Of Activity In The Fuel Cell Space And The Auto Industry

The new funding being invested by Tokyo is expected to build approximately 35 new hydrogen fuel stations in the city. The Tokyo government is also in negotiations with both Toyota and Honda to bring 6,000 new fuel cell vehicles to the roads by 2020, before the Olympic Games. The government notes that the Olympics is a good time to showcase new technology to those that will be visiting the country.

TOKYO IS SHOWING AGGRESSIVE SUPPORT FOR HYDROGEN FUEL AHEAD OF THE OLYMPIC GAMES

Japan is growing bolder with its support of hydrogen fuel. Tokyo has plans to inject some 330 million into the hydrogen fuel space ahead of the 2020 Olympics. Because the city will be hosting the Olympic Games, Tokyo officials are taking the opportunity to show off the capabilities of fuel cell technology. These energy systems can produce electrical power by consuming hydrogen fuel, producing only water vapor and oxygen as a byproduct.

INITIATIVE WAS INSPIRED BY TOYOTA'S INTERESTS IN FUEL CELLS


The plan from the Tokyo Metropolitan Government was inspired by Japanese automaker Toyota. While Japan, as a whole, has been showing strong support for hydrogen fuel cells, the new plan came into being after Toyota announced that it would be releasing a hydrogen-powered vehicle in Japan. Tokyo hopes to have at least 6,000 fuel cell vehicles roaming its streets by 2020, and is preparing to launch an initiative that will make this dream possible.

Money Will Help Build New Hydrogen Fuel Stations And Bring New Vehicles To Tokyo

The money that Tokyo has set aside will be used to build 35 new hydrogen fuel stations, which will be located near venues hosting Olympic events. The money will also help the city acquire more fuel cell buses, which will be used to transport athletes competing in the Olympic Games. By 2025, Tokyo hopes that there will be more than 100,000 fuel cell vehicles and 80 hydrogen fuel stations in the city, making it one of the largest hubs for clean transportation.

Japan's Olympic Village Will Be Powered By Hydrogen Fuel Cells

As is custom for the Olympic Games, a small township is being built for those that will be participating in the event. The Olympic Village, as it is called, will serve as a home for athletes and will offer all the amenities that can be found in a conventional town. The Japanese government has plans to ensure that the village will be entirely powered by hydrogen fuel, making it the most environmentally friendly Olympic Village that has ever been built.

GOVERNMENT AGENCIES AIM TO INTRODUCE MORE FUNDING FOR THE ADVANCEMENT OF FUEL CELL TECHNOLOGIES

The United States Office of Energy Efficiency and Renewable Energy (EERE) has produced a Notice of Intent regarding funding opportunities for the hydrogen fuel cell sector. The Notice of Intent was posted on behalf of the Fuel Cell Technologies Office, which promotes the use of fuel cells in various sectors and supports the advancement of this technology. Fuel cells have been gaining momentum in the United States, especially when it comes to the transportation sector. These energy systems are still notoriously expensive, however, which makes them less attractive than other clean technologies.

35 MILLION MAY BE AVAILABLE FOR THE FUEL CELL SECTOR


The EERE plans to make some 35 million available for the advancement of hydrogen fuel cell technology. This funding will be issued through the Fuel Cell Technologies Office, but the agencies are still seeking approval to provide this funding. The funding may help aid the early of adoption of fuel cell technologies. This technology is becoming particularly famous in the auto industry, but fuel cells have been used for industrial purposes for several years.

Funding Aims To Help Improve The Manufacture Of Fuel Cells And Reduce Their Need For Platinum

Funding to improve fuel cell technology could make these energy systems more affordable in the future. The funding will focus on hydrogen fuel production research and development, reducing the amount of platinum needed when manufacturing fuel cell systems, and improving the fuel cell manufacturing process overall. Reducing the need for platinum may help make fuel cells significantly less expensive. Currently, fuel cells use catalysts made from platinum, which allow them to generate electrical power in a relatively efficient manner.

Department Of Energy Also Funding Advancement Of Fuel Cell Technology

The EERE aims to issue funding for the improvement of fuel cell technology in February of this year. This funding will augment other money that the Department of Energy is funneling into the fuel cell sector. The agency believes that hydrogen fuel cells have a major role to play in the future of clean transportation, but is also funding the advancement of battery technology for more conventional electric vehicles.
